Northern Ireland based Bridgedale Outdoor, a maker of performance socks for outdoor and sport, has won the Socks of the Year Award by Trail Running Magazine for its Bridgedale Trail Run Lightweight T2 Merino Performance socks.

Socks in Bridgedale’s Trail Run range are said to deliver fantastic comfort for those running, hiking or biking on the world’s great trails. Fusion technology maximises the benefits of natural and technical fibres, knit in such a way as to create a highly ventilated and perfectly cushioned sock providing advanced fit and comfort.

Trail Run are available with two weights of cushioning, just where runners need it for impact protection on uneven terrain. The Lightweight socks are deemed to be perfect for colder runs all year round, and Ultralight is recommended for warmer conditions and summer runs. There are also some non-wool, vegan friendly styles in the range.

Bridgedale’s Trail Run range was developed by working closely with a team of testers across the UK, all of whom are regular off-road trail runners who run between 45 and 200 miles per week. By testing and tweaking the products at every stage of development, the runners have told the company that it has developed the most comfortable and durable trail running socks they have ever used.

“I am thrilled to share with you the recent award we have won for our newly launched Trail RUN socks. We developed this collection by working closely with 30 amateur enthusiast Trail Runners over a two-year period to really understand what they wanted in a sock. The award is recognition of their inputs and the success of the Team in our factory in Northern Ireland to deliver against the brief,” commented Mark Brennan, Managing Director, Bridgedale Outdoor Limited.

“We introduced some brand-new features in these socks, such as the zero debris cuff and a reinforced, natural toe box – all part of the Bridgedale Sport Fit, designed to protect your feet and enhance your performance whilst running up and down hills and trails,” the company said.

“We are the first brand to use the new innovative Lycra Dry technology that helps bring long-lasting fit with the comfort of dry feet.”

Bridgedale Outdoor Ltd is located at the tip of the Strangford Lough, Newtownards, near Belfast in Northern Ireland, under the shadow of the Scrabo Tower which was built as a monument to Lord Londonderry. The factory there has been knitting socks in Newtownards since WW1, when the first army socks were made. The strong heritage in hosiery is a feature of the Bridgedale brand and several of the team have been working in the factory for over 40 years.

When the first Bridgedales were launched in the early 1980's there were 3 colours, 2 sizes and 2 lengths, just 12 products. Now the company has over 500 products in the range and has factories in Northern Ireland and South Africa.
